Own a Smart System? Lutron Fits In Seamlessly 

Lutron’s motorized shades are arguably the best on the market. Available as roller shades, blinds, and drapes in countless fabrics, Lutron’s shades can be automated to follow specific schedules with whisper-quiet motors. 

But another benefit of Lutron shades is their ability to integrate with other home automation systems. If you already use a smart system like Savant or Control4, here’s what you can expect when you add Lutron shades.
